Digital control of diode laser for atmospheric spectroscopy |
摘要 |
A system for remote absorption spectroscopy of trace species using a diode laser (14) tunable over a useful spectral region of 50 to 200 cm-1 by control of diode laser temperature over range from 15 DEG K. to 100 DEG K., and tunable over a smaller region of typically 0.1 to 10 cm-1 by control of the diode laser current over a range from 0 to 2 amps. Diode laser temperature and current set points are transmitted to the instrument in digital form and stored in memory (32) for retrieval under control of a microprocessor (28) during measurements. The laser diode current is determined by a digital-to-analog converter (62) through a field-effect transistor (Q1) for a high degree of ambient temperature stability, while the laser diode temperature is determined by set points entered into a digital-to-analog converter (64) under control of the microprocessor. Temperature of the laser diode is sensed by a sensor diode (18) to provide negative feedback to the temperature control circuit that responds to the temperature control digital-to-analog converter (64).
